What Is a GI Carrot?
Before diving into the benefits, it’s important to clarify what “GI carrot” means. The term refers to carrots that have a low glycemic index—a measure of how quickly foods raise blood glucose levels after eating. Foods with a low GI value (55 or less) release glucose slowly, promoting stable blood sugar and sustained energy. Carrots score around 35 to 45 on the GI scale, making them an excellent option for those monitoring blood sugar or looking to maintain steady energy throughout the day.
Stunning Benefits of Including GI Carrot in Your Diet
1. Supports Blood Sugar Regulation
One of the most significant perks of consuming low GI foods like carrots is their ability to help regulate blood sugar. For people with diabetes or insulin resistance, managing spikes and crashes in blood glucose is crucial. Since GI carrots release glucose slowly, they prevent rapid increases in blood sugar, reducing the risk of insulin spikes and associated complications. Including carrots as a snack or meal component can contribute to better glycemic control.
2. Helps in Weight Management
GI carrots promote feelings of fullness because of their fiber content and slow digestion rate. This can be highly beneficial for those aiming to lose or maintain weight, as stable blood sugar levels help prevent cravings and unnecessary snacking. Additionally, carrots are low in calories but high in nutrients, which makes them a satisfying, nutrient-dense choice to incorporate into meals without excess calorie intake.
3. Rich Nutrient Profile
Beyond their low glycemic impact, carrots are packed with essential vitamins and minerals that support overall health. They are an excellent source of beta-carotene, which converts to vitamin A — vital for eye health, immune function, and skin vitality. Carrots also provide vitamin K1, potassium, and antioxidants that fight oxidative stress and inflammation. This nutrient density makes GI carrots a fantastic addition to any health-conscious diet.
4. Enhances Digestive Health
The dietary fiber found in GI carrots is beneficial for the digestive system. Fiber adds bulk to the stool and helps maintain regular bowel movements, reducing the risk of constipation. A healthy gut flora can also be supported by the prebiotic properties of carrot fiber, enhancing digestion and nutrient absorption. Including GI carrots regularly helps keep your digestive system running smoothly.
How to Include GI Carrot in Your Best Healthy Diet
Incorporating GI carrots into your meals is easier and more versatile than you might think. Here are some simple and delicious ways:
– Raw snacks: Crunchy carrot sticks make a perfect snack alongside hummus or yogurt dip.
– Salads: Shred or julienne carrots into leafy green salads for added color, texture, and nutrition.
– Roasted dishes: Toss sliced carrots in olive oil, herbs, and spices, then roast until tender and caramelized.
– Soups and stews: Add chopped carrots early in cooking to infuse flavor and nutrients into your soups and stews.
– Smoothies: Blend carrots with fruits like oranges, mangoes, or apples for a refreshing and nutrient-packed drink.
